# Agent field notes — scrabble-game
Non-obvious, hard-won project knowledge that is **not** in the main docs (`CLAUDE.md`, `docs/*`,
`deploy/README.md`). Kept in the repo so it travels with a clone to any host. These are working
memory, not a spec — **verify any named file / flag / function against the current code before acting
on it**, and prefer the authoritative docs where they overlap. Add to this file as new gotchas turn up.
## Codegen & build
- **jetgen churns everything.** `backend/cmd/jetgen` regenerates go-jet code for *all* tables and may
reorder output. After running it, revert the churn on tables you did not touch and commit only your
table's change.
- **flatc is version-pinned** (`pkg/Makefile`, `REQUIRED_FLATC = 23.5.26`, hard-checked). A different
flatc silently churns the generated wire code and can flip wire defaults. Never regenerate FBS with
another flatc version.
- **gopls lags codegen.** Right after an FBS/jet regen, gopls shows phantom "undefined" errors. Trust
`go build` / `go test`, not the editor squiggles.
- **go-jet type mapping:** SQL `numeric``float64`, `interval``string`. Never store money as
`numeric` (float precision loss) — use **bigint minor units + a `Money` type**; store durations as
**int seconds**, not `interval`.
- **`go mod tidy` chokes on dot-free local module paths** (`scrabble/...`). Hand-edit `go.mod` when a
bump is needed. The solver (`../scrabble-solver`) is consumed via `go.work` replace locally, but a
prod bump goes through a solver **PR → master + a published tag**, not a local replace.
- **Run the whole CI suite locally before pushing** — unit + integration (`//go:build integration`,
Postgres) + the UI job + codegen check. Do not lean on CI to catch what a local run would.
- **CI runner shares this host's `/tmp` as a different user.** In workflow steps, write artifacts to
`${GITHUB_WORKSPACE}`, never a fixed `/tmp/...` path (cross-user permission failures otherwise).
- **pnpm corepack pre-flight flakes.** `pnpm exec` / `pnpm check` occasionally abort on a corepack
pre-flight. Dodge it by invoking the tool directly: `node_modules/.bin/<tool>`.

## Wire / schema evolution (client ↔ gateway ↔ backend)
- **FBS is additive-only.** Add **trailing** fields ("added trailing — backward-compatible"). Never
delete or reorder a mid-table field — **deprecate** it (`(deprecated)`); deleting shifts field IDs
and breaks older readers.
- **Retiring a domain field must also retire the WIRE field it fed** — by deprecation, not deletion,
and do not just zero it: a dead `0` the client dutifully syncs will clobber the real value.
- **The gateway transcodes FBS ↔ backend JSON DTOs in lockstep.** A wire change usually means editing
both the FBS schema and the backend DTO.
- **Seat display name is built in two places** — `game.Service` live events **and** the server REST
DTOs. Change both or they drift.
- **A per-viewer flag is computed only in the per-viewer REST DTO**; the client seeds it from REST,
then bumps it from the live event. Don't expect it on the shared broadcast.
## UI / Svelte 5
- **Never name a `$state` variable `state`.** `svelte-check` then misreads `$state` as a store
subscription. Rename (e.g. `view`).
- **Svelte trims literal edge whitespace** in markup. To keep a separator space, emit an expression:
`{' : '}`.
- **No global `.btn` / `.ghost` button classes.** Style buttons per-component with scoped CSS + design
tokens (mirror `NewGame`'s `.invite`).
- **A `$state` proxy fails structured-clone** when persisted to IndexedDB. Snapshot at the call site
with `$state.snapshot(...)` before storing.
## Platform / WebView quirks (Telegram, VK, iOS, native, old Android)
- **Telegram `showPopup` eats the user-activation.** Share / clipboard called from inside a
`showPopup` callback fail (no gesture). Use your own `Modal` for gesture-gated Web APIs.
- **iOS Telegram `<a download blob:>` navigates away** and strands the SPA. Deliver files by **Web
Share on mobile**, and only use a `<a download>` Blob path on **desktop**.
- **Android TG/VK WebViews** lack `navigator.share` and ignore `<a download>`. Deliver a
client-generated file by **copying it to the clipboard**.
- **VK Android WebView ignores `target=_blank`.** Open external links through `lib/links.ts`
(routes to `vk.com/away.php`). Verify on-device.
- **Per-platform file-delivery last hop differs** (TG / VK / plain browser) — there is a delivery
matrix; do not re-litigate it without new on-device facts.
- **Old Android System WebView floor ≈ Chrome 67.** The bundle targets **es2019** (esbuild lowers
syntax), a conditional `core-js` polyfill loads only on old engines, and `index.html` has a boot
gate (BigInt / Proxy are the hard block → the unsupported-engine screen). There's also a `vmin`
glyph fallback for old rendering.
- **iOS WKWebView overscroll and Telegram swipe-to-close are not reproducible in Playwright.** Verify
those live on the deployed contour, not in the e2e.
- **Telegram Desktop Mini App shows a persistent bottom-right loader** — that's the long-lived
Subscribe stream, cosmetic, deliberately left as-is.

## The client-version gate — architecture (read before touching gate code)
**Principle: the version rides the outermost, permanently-stable layer, never the FlatBuffers
payload.** The transport is two layers: a protobuf Connect envelope
(`ExecuteRequest{message_type, payload, request_id}`, `gateway/proto/edge/v1/edge.proto`) wrapping a
FlatBuffers payload (`pkg/fbs/scrabble.fbs`). Protobuf envelopes and HTTP headers are
version-tolerant by design; the FBS payload is the layer that breaks. So the client version rides in
an **HTTP header `X-Client-Version`**, read by the gateway **before it decodes the payload**.
**Enforcement is per-call, not a dedicated init RPC.** The client attaches the header to every
Connect call via its single `headers()` builder; the gateway checks it at the top of `Execute`
(before registry lookup / auth / payload decode) and `Subscribe`. The first online call the app makes
(session establish `auth.*`) is thus gated automatically — no `Hello` RPC needed. A too-old client
makes **zero** successful requests but sees a recognizable signal, not a crash.
**Two return shapes, one meaning:**
- `Execute` → the domain-style envelope `result_code = "update_required"` (HTTP 200); the client
already throws `GatewayError(result_code)` for any non-`ok`.
- `Subscribe` → Connect `CodeFailedPrecondition` (a stream has no `result_code`).
**Frozen contract (write into `docs/ARCHITECTURE.md` §2):** three things become permanent so any
build, however old, can always recognize "update required": (1) the protobuf envelope field numbers
in `edge.proto` are never renumbered/reused; (2) the `update_required` sentinel (the `result_code`
string + the `FailedPrecondition` code) never changes; (3) the FBS schema stays **additive**
(trailing fields only, `(deprecated)` never delete). Breaking changes happen only *inside* the FBS
payload.
**Discipline (write into `deploy/README.md`):** the production deploy that ships an incompatible wire
change **also** bumps `GATEWAY_MIN_CLIENT_VERSION` to that release, in the same rollout. Until
deliberately set, `GATEWAY_MIN_CLIENT_VERSION` is **empty ⇒ the gate is dormant and web behaviour is
unchanged.** One hard threshold for the MVP; a soft "recommended update" tier is deferred.
**Interaction with offline-first (important UX rule):** offline mode uses the network kill switch
(`transport.ts assertOnline`), so the gate never fires while playing offline — an old client can
always play local vs_ai/hotseat. The gate matters only for online actions. Therefore the terminal
"update" overlay must be raised **only on a user-initiated online action**, never on the silent
background guest-reconciliation: if reconciliation's `auth.guest` returns `update_required`, swallow
it and stay a local guest (do not overlay). Implementation seam: the reconciliation path catches the
`update_required` code and does not route it to the global overlay trigger; foreground calls do.

// Package clientver parses and compares the leading MAJOR.MINOR.PATCH of a client
// version string so the edge can turn away a build too old to speak the current wire
// contract. It is deliberately dependency-free and tolerant: the version rides an HTTP
// header (X-Client-Version) that a build stamps from `git describe --tags`, so any
// `-N-gSHA` or `+meta` suffix is ignored, and anything unparseable is reported as such
// (the caller fails open — an absent or garbled header is never treated as too old).
package clientver
import (
"strconv"
"strings"
)
// Version is a parsed semantic version triple. Only MAJOR.MINOR.PATCH participate in the
// ordering; any pre-release or build suffix is dropped at parse time.
type Version struct {
Major, Minor, Patch int
}
// Parse extracts the leading MAJOR.MINOR.PATCH from s, tolerating an optional leading
// "v" and any `-N-gSHA` or `+meta` suffix (as produced by `git describe --tags`). It
// reports ok=false when s has fewer than three numeric components or any component is not
// an integer, so the caller can distinguish a real version from a dev/empty string.
func Parse(s string) (Version, bool) {
s = strings.TrimPrefix(strings.TrimSpace(s), "v")
if i := strings.IndexAny(s, "-+"); i >= 0 {
s = s[:i]
}
p := strings.SplitN(s, ".", 4)
if len(p) < 3 {
return Version{}, false
}
var v Version
var err error
if v.Major, err = strconv.Atoi(p[0]); err != nil {
return Version{}, false
}
if v.Minor, err = strconv.Atoi(p[1]); err != nil {
return Version{}, false
}
if v.Patch, err = strconv.Atoi(p[2]); err != nil {
return Version{}, false
}
return v, true
}
// Less reports whether a orders before b by MAJOR, then MINOR, then PATCH. Equal versions
// are not Less than each other, so a client exactly at the minimum passes the gate.
func Less(a, b Version) bool {
if a.Major != b.Major {
return a.Major < b.Major
}
if a.Minor != b.Minor {
return a.Minor < b.Minor
}
return a.Patch < b.Patch
}
